Is eltern feminine or plural?

There is no singular of “Eltern”. It is the plural word for “Vater and Mutter” (or whoever is parenting). “Der Elternteil” can translate to “the parent.

Is Meine eltern plural?

Possession or ownership of an object is indicated using possessive pronoun and the word mein is used. Meine is used to indicate feminine gender or plural form. So my mother becomes meine mutter while my father remains mein Vater. It is also meine eltern for my parents as the pronoun is in the plural in this example.

How do you know if a word is feminine or masculine in German?

So instead of referring to a word’s meaning, gender refers to the word itself. To point out the gender of nouns, you use different gender markers. The three gender markers that mean the (singular) in German are der (masculine), die (feminine), and das (neuter). The plural form of the definite article is die.

What is the Artikel for eltern?

Declension Eltern
Singular Plural
Nom. die Eltern
Gen. der Eltern
Dat. den Eltern
Acc. die Eltern

How do you say dog in German?

The word for dog in German is quite simple and short, which is rather surprising considering what language we are talking about. It is (der) Hund. It is pronounced [hʊnt] in the IPA transcription. It has the same origin as the English hound, and the plural form is Hunde.

How do you say family in German?

The word for family in German is die Familie, pronounced “dee Fuh-mil-e-uh.” If you want to say “my family,” you would say meine Familie, since Familie is feminine (die) and the -e ending denotes that.

What is the plural of cousin in German?

der Cousin
Singular Plural
Nominativ (Wer? Was?) der Cousin die Cousins
Genitiv (Wessen?) des Cousins der Cousins
Dativ (Wem?) dem Cousin den Cousins
Akkusativ (Wen? Was?) den Cousin die Cousins

How do Germans address their parents?

The most common would be Mama and Papa which translates loosely to Mom and Dad. I would say that most Germans call their parents that, if they address them directly. It is the most intimate choice of words. Vati and Mutti are terribly old-fashioned.

How do German greet each other?

The most common greeting is a handshake with direct eye contact. … Close friends may hug to greet and younger people may kiss one another on the cheek. “Guten Tag” (Good day) or “Hallo” (Hello) are the most common verbal greetings used in Germany.

What is your name German meaning?

How to Say What Is Your Name in German. If you want to say “What is your name?” in German, you would either say, “Wie heißen sie?” (formal) or “Wie heißt du?” (informal).
